About the Role

The Facilities Manager will oversee the complete lifecycle of MATSYS facilities, from site identification and buildout through daily operations, optimization, and decommissioning. This is a high‑impact role responsible for facility reliability, safety, compliance, and readiness to support a fast‑moving, engineering‑centric environment. You will collaborate across Operations, EHS, IT, Finance, and external partners to ensure our buildings, systems, and workspaces operate at the highest standard. This role is ideal for someone who thrives in a growing organization and enjoys combining hands‑on problem solving with strategic planning.

Responsibilities
  • Facilities Strategy & Lifecycle Management
  • Identify and evaluate new facility opportunities aligned with MATSYS growth.
  • Lead site selection, due diligence, and space planning.
  • Manage the full lifecycle of each facility: acquisition, buildout, operation, optimization, consolidation, and closure.
  • Lead lease negotiations and manage landlord relationships.
  • Oversee key service contracts (HVAC, janitorial, landscaping, security, waste, etc.).
  • Track lease requirements, critical dates, and CAM reconciliations.
  • Building Systems (MEP) & Critical Environments
  • Oversee mechanical, electrical, plumbing, and building automation systems.
  • Manage critical environments such as labs, server rooms, manufacturing areas, and controlled‑temperature spaces.
  • Develop and manage preventive and predictive maintenance programs.
  • Utilities, Energy & Sustainability
  • Manage utility procurement and monitoring for energy, water, gas, and waste.
  • Drive sustainability initiatives and identify opportunities for efficiency improvement.
  • Construction, Renovations & Capital Projects
  • Oversee renovation projects, facility improvements, and buildouts.
  • Coordinate contractors, architects, engineers, and permitting.
  • Manage project scope, schedule, budgets, and FF&E requirements.
  • Operations, Safety & Compliance
  • Oversee day‑to‑day building operations, repairs, and work‑order management.
  • Maintain CMMS systems and operational KPIs.
  • Ensure compliance with OSHA, ADA, environmental regulations, and building codes.
  • Support EHS programs, emergency preparedness, and inspections.
  • Budgeting & Team Leadership
  • Develop and manage facilities operating and capital budgets.
  • Lead internal facilities staff and manage external contractor teams.
Qualifications
  • Bachelor’s degree in Facilities Management, Engineering, Construction Management, Business, or equivalent experience.
  • 7+ years of facilities management experience; 3+ years in a leadership capacity.
  • Experience across the full facility lifecycle — site selection through operations.
  • Strong knowledge of MEP systems and building automation.
  • Experience managing leases, vendors, and capital projects.
  • Familiarity with CMMS and BMS systems.
  • Knowledge of OSHA, ADA, fire/life‑safety, and environmental compliance requirements.
  • Strong organizational, communication, and project‑management skills.
Preferred Skills
  • Experience supporting laboratory, manufacturing, or mission‑critical environments.
  • IFMA FMP/CFM, BOMI, PMP, or LEED certification.
  • Background in advanced materials, aerospace/defense, manufacturing, or technology sectors.
  • Experience with security systems, emergency planning, or business continuity programs.
